Olympiakos won the Greek Super Cup with a Portuguese (or almost Portuguese) touch in the mix. The starting eleven included Gelson Martins, Chiquinho, Daniel Podence and Iranian Mehdi Taremi, who caught the eye at Rio Ave and FC Porto. On the bench, there were three more players who had spent time in Portugal: Yaremchuk, Diogo Nascimento and Costinha. In a closely contested game over the 90 minutes, it was necessary to wait for 30 minutes of extra time to see goals: and when they arrived, they arrived with force. Mehdi Taremi, a dead ball specialist, opened the penalty count in the 95th minute. Goals from Kalogeropoulos (minute 107) and Yusuf Yazici followed, assisted by former Rio Ave player Costinha, making the score 3-0 in the 103rd minute.
